Transaction 21becabd759ae6c6ac52ee6bc0688e4d979606ce292d9d9a32a63e9fa368c2ac
1 Input
1 Output
-
21becabd759ae6c6ac52ee6bc0688e4d979606ce292d9d9a32a63e9fa368c2ac:0
- value
- 1564876
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e33b9d94d3bec1aaa002bbe7a65ff78889c44810 OP_EQUAL
- address
- 3NQWjFUjgpazdc1Pb6d2PSf1bEAZskdWjs